Single liver lobe repopulation with wildtype hepatocytes using regional hepatic irradiation cures jaundice in Gunn rats.

Hongchao Zhou | Xinyuan Dong | Rafi Kabarriti | Yong Chen | Yesim Avsar | Xia Wang | Jianqiang Ding | Laibin Liu | Ira J Fox | Jayanta Roy-Chowdhury | Namita Roy-Chowdhury | Chandan Guha
PloS one | 2012

Preparative hepatic irradiation (HIR), together with mitotic stimulation of hepatocytes, permits extensive hepatic repopulation by transplanted hepatocytes in rats and mice. However, whole liver HIR is associated with radiation-induced liver disease (RILD), which limits its potential therapeutic application. In clinical experience, restricting HIR to a fraction of the liver reduces the susceptibility to RILD. Here we test the hypothesis that repopulation of selected liver lobes by regional HIR should be sufficient to correct some inherited metabolic disorders.
